| Stage 3 - Formulation of Advice to the Minister | This assessment was considered by the MSAC at the 21 May 2003 meeting. Since there is currently insufficient evidence pertaining to HPV testing for cervical screening, the MSAC recommended that public funding should not be supported at this time. |
| Stage 4 - Decision | Endorsed by the Minister for Health and Ageing 8 August 2003 |
